Inventory that sits on your lot without professional video or high-quality photos is essentially invisible to the modern digital shopper. Traditionally, fixing this meant hiring expensive agencies or pulling your best sales reps off the floor to play photographer.
AI content creation for dealerships has shifted the math. By using automated background removal and photo-to-video engines, dealers can now take raw lot photos and transform them into cinematic VDP assets in minutes. The needle moves here because "Time to Web" drops from 48 hours to under 10 minutes, significantly reducing interest carry costs on every unit.
The highest intent leads often arrive when your sales team is asleep. A generic auto-responder is a "lead killer"—it tells the customer to wait, giving them eight hours to find another dealer who is actually awake.
Enter the AI spokesperson for car sales. This isn't just a chatbot; it's a visual, interactive concierge that can answer specific technical questions, provide trade-in ranges, and even send a personalized video greeting. By humanizing the digital experience at the point of inquiry, you aren't just collecting data; you are starting a relationship.
Finally, the needle moves when you stop wasting money on broad-spectrum ads. AI marketing for car dealerships analyzes your CRM data to find "lookalike" buyers in your local area who are currently in-market for the specific inventory you have in oversupply.
Instead of a generic "Truck Month" campaign, the AI serves a video ad of a specific Black Silverado to a shopper who has spent the last 48 hours searching for that exact trim level. This precision reduces your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C) and ensures your marketing dollars are working as hard as your sales team.
